None other PHP solution exists to find out the minimum version and the extensions required for a piece of code to run.

Features

  • parse a single file
  • parse a folder/directory
  • parse an array (list of file)
  • ability to give a list of functions to ignore when calculating the version needed
  • ability to give a list of directories to ignore when calculating the version needed
  • ability to go recursively or not into folder to find files
  • ability to reduce or extends list of extensions to parse for PHP code
  • ability to give a list of constants to ignore when calculating the version needed. Available since version 1.2.0
  • ability to get list of functions related to a PHP version (or a subset). Available since version 1.2.0
  • ability to give a list of (related functions of) php modules/extensions to ignore when calculating the version needed. Available since version 1.4.0
  • ability to give a list of (related functions of) php versions to ignore when calculating the version needed. Available since version 1.4.0
  • ability to exclude from parsing scope, some functions, extensions, constants, based on conditionnal code. Available since version 1.7.0
  • ability to know conditional code (such as function_exists) used by php scripts. Available since version 1.7.0
